Why You Should Hire an Asbestos Attorney

A skilled asbestos attorney may help you pursue claims against the parties responsible for the exposure. They can also guide you through the settlement or lawsuit process towards the most favorable result.

Mesothelioma and lung cancer can be caused by asbestos exposure in high-risk jobs such as construction workers, shipyard workers, and Navy seamen. A New York asbestos attorney can simplify the legal process and increase your chances of receiving compensation for damages.

Knowledge of State Laws

A good asbestos lawyer must be knowledgeable of all laws regarding asbestos in the state that you reside in. This information can assist you in filing a suit against asbestos manufacturers, distributors and employers who exposed you to the dangers of this mineral. They can also assist with filing claims with asbestos trust funds created by bankrupt companies accountable for asbestos legal contamination.

A lawyer who has a proven track of success in mesothelioma cases is a must. This includes recent wins, large settlements and verdicts in trials. In addition, a good New York asbestos attorney should offer a contingency-based payment plan. This means you only pay only if they win your case.

During an initial consultation, you must bring any documents that could relate to your exposure and illness. You can bring medical records, including chest x-rays as well as the results of tests. Your attorney can then review this information and determine whether you qualify for compensation.

They can also help you file an asbestos lawsuit against the responsible party which could include asbestos-containing product manufacturers and asbestos insurance companies and construction firms that handled asbestos law-containing material improperly. They can help you decide which defendants to name in your lawsuit, and will explain how the law affects your chances of receiving an appropriate settlement.

In many instances, it is required for your asbestos attorney hire an expert to show that your condition was caused by exposure to asbestos. Experts will present reports or testify in trials and depositions. They can prove causation, which is crucial to obtaining a fair settlement.

Asbestos litigation can be controlled by a myriad of laws and regulations, which vary from state to state. Some of these concerns include the requirements for medical professionals, minimum medical requirements, regulations governing two diseases, expedited scheduling, and joinders. New York is among the states which have passed asbestos legislation. For instance the James L. Zadroga 9/11 Health & Compensation Act aids first responders suffering health conditions due to their work at the World Trade Center following the attacks.

Ability to Negotiate

A lawyer who is specialized in asbestos litigation can effectively negotiate with the businesses involved in the case. This is crucial because many victims don't want to go to trial. They prefer to settle. This will help them avoid the anxiety of a trial and let them receive their compensation earlier than they would otherwise. Trials are open to the public, which is why they can help them maintain their privacy. It is possible that companies involved in a trial may be hesitant to risk their name being associated with the case, as it could damage their image.

To get fair compensation for an asbestos claim, you will need to do a lot of information gathering and research. Your lawyer will review your medical records, your employment record (if you were in the military) and bills, receipts and other documents so that they can make a convincing case. This could be a lengthy process and your lawyer will stay at your side throughout the entire process.

After gathering the information you need the lawyer will file a lawsuit on your behalf. Then they will determine who is accountable for your injuries. Former employers or property owners, as well as manufacturers of asbestos-related products or equipment could be included. Your lawyer will also research any potential asbestos trust funds that you could be entitled to claim.

The discovery process is an important element of settlement negotiations. During this process your attorney will ask documents from the defendants in your case. They will also conduct depositions which are sworn statements that can be used in your trial. Your attorney will prepare you for the deposition beforehand and will be there for you throughout the process.

You may be entitled to compensation. If you win, you can use your settlement to pay for medical expenses, loss of income, emotional distress, and loss of quality-of-life. If you're suing to secure the benefit of a loved one's the settlement may also be used to pay for funeral and burial expenses.
